About Kingsgrove Woodland Walk and Trim Trail
The trim trail equipment is scattered throughout, so if you're the sort who likes a bit of structured exercise on a walk, it breaks things up nicely. Nothing fancy - pull-up bars, stepping logs, balance beams - but it serves its purpose. The woodland itself is the real draw though. It's proper quiet, especially on weekday mornings. You'll see woodland birds if you're patient, and the whole thing's accessible enough for families with kids who can manage a decent stroll.
Worth allowing a solid hour if you're doing the full circuit and stopping at the trim stations. The paths are well-kept, though they can be muddy after rain - worth knowing before you set out. It's the kind of place that's genuinely free and genuinely worth it, which is rare enough these days.
